Every night the residents of Los Angeles leave their apartments in search of the most attractive people in town, and though there are numerous clubs that bring in some beautiful folks, none guarantee quite as good a time as a night at LAX. This airport-themed nightclub has everything you could want in a club, and some of the hottest and hippest folks call this club home every night. It may be hard to get in the door some nights, but its well worth the wait most nights, because once you get in, you're in for the time of your life. When it comes time for many of LA's elite to throw a party, LAX is a common location. They offer fantastic opportunities for those wanting to throw a huge party, surrounded by some of the most beautiful folks in town. It's also a popular spot for the biggest industry parties, fashion shows, or other star-studded affairs. If you're not looking for a big private party, you can always dance the night away with all the Los Angeles hotness, where you can shake your thing to the music of some of the most famous mix-masters in the industry, including the world famous DJ AM. No matter what you want to do with your evening, this hip club is sure to offer you exactly what you're up for. Plenty of clubs offer the most beautiful folks in town, but fewer make good on their offer as well as LAX. Hip apartment-ites shuffle into this Los Angeles hot spot in droves, for some of the greatest music, greatest ambiance, and the greatest crowd in town.
Frequently Asked Questions about Los Angeles
How much are Studio apartments in Los Angeles?
There are currently 30,259 Studio Apartments in Los Angeles with rent ranges from $695 to $10,005 with an average price of $2,148.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Los Angeles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Los Angeles ranges from $601 to $19,920 with an average monthly rent of $2,669.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Los Angeles c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Los Angeles range from $825 to $39,303.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,567.
How expensive are Los Angeles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 10,053 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Los Angeles on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$799 to $43,550 - averaging $4,882 for the location.
